Transaction 53ceca633de7170d4d69848912b210f3f680449c7dcd0a0faa80940b9ab90641

116 Input
2 Outputs
  • 53ceca633de7170d4d69848912b210f3f680449c7dcd0a0faa80940b9ab90641:0
  • value  989369
    address  38WXXEoyy1mn2aufSe6Uy1eWqHCqbCJ7Z9
  • 53ceca633de7170d4d69848912b210f3f680449c7dcd0a0faa80940b9ab90641:1
  • value  409245145
    address  3MbLuZqCyAcjJy9ZQFJ9GbhdGsfeiMia7P